Thank you for your reminder! I think you don't have to tell me to read the document.
I have done that many times already. My feeling after reading the "creating package" manual is that my god, this job needs a Computer Science degree to do it. It is way too complicated. There should be simpler ways. Perhaps I don't need a package. I just need to be able to call my "clearscreen" function from all of my other scripts... Where do I put my "clearscreen" function? Is there a command similar to "include" in C++? Is there a path management that I can call "clearscreen" function from anywhere as long as its in path?
